### Initial Reports and Emergency Response
The incident at Silver Lake Nursing Home, located at 905 Tower Road in Bristol, Pennsylvania, was first reported around 2:30 p.m. on Tuesday, December 23rd. First responders, including the Bensalem Volunteer Fire Department, were immediately dispatched to the scene. The fire quickly escalated to a two-alarm blaze, signifying the need for substantial resources and a coordinated response. Emergency crews responded to a reported explosion
at the facility,prompting a large-scale evacuation effort. Initial reports indicate that the explosion originated within the building,but the precise source remains under investigation. Photographic evidence captured by Isabelle hower, a local photographer, depicts visible damage to the structure, with smoke billowing from the affected areas.As of this update, authorities have not released detailed information regarding potential injuries, but the scale of the incident suggests a possibility of casualties. The Bucks County Emergency Management Agency is coordinating the response,working to provide support and resources to both the residents and the responding personnel.

### Potential Causes and Contributing Factors
While the investigation is ongoing, several potential causes for the explosion are being considered. Aging infrastructure is a significant concern in many long-term care facilities across the nation. A 2024 report by LeadingAge, a non-profit association representing aging services providers, highlighted that over 60% of nursing homes in the US are more than 30 years old
, increasing the risk of system failures and accidents. Possible contributing factors include gas leaks, electrical malfunctions, or issues with the building’s heating system. the presence of medical gases, such as oxygen, within the facility could also exacerbate the impact of an explosion.Moreover, the potential for human error, such as improper maintenance or accidental ignition, cannot be ruled out. The investigation will likely involve a thorough examination of the facility’s maintenance records,safety protocols,and recent inspection reports. It’s also crucial to consider whether recent weather events, such as the severe storms experienced in the Northeast in late 2025, may have contributed to any structural weaknesses.
